Why does the moon have a layer of powdery "soil" on its surface?

Lunar soil is the fine fraction of the regolith found on the surface of the moon. Its properties can differ significantly from those of terrestrial soil.

The powdery soil is the result of tons tiny impacts by small particles striking the Moon.
